Beach-Themed Decor Ideas

Drawing inspiration from Naples’ stunning coastal charm, let’s explore some beach-themed decor ideas that can infuse your home with a refreshing seaside vibe.

Consider incorporating a soft, neutral color palette to mirror the serene landscapes of Naples’ beaches. Shades of blue, reminiscent of the sea, combined with sandy tones, can provide a calming base for your decor. Don’t shy away from adding a pop of coral or turquoise for a vibrant splash.

Natural materials, such as driftwood, seashells, or jute, can add a tactile element, imbuing your rooms with an organic feel. Try a driftwood coffee table or throw pillows adorned with seashell patterns. These subtle nods to beach life can evoke the relaxed pace of Naples without feeling kitschy.

Lighting, often overlooked, is crucial in achieving a beach-themed ambiance. Opt for arrangements that mimic the soft, diffused light of a beach at sunset. Lantern-style lighting fixtures or lamps with a rattan or wicker base can enhance the coastal atmosphere.

Lastly, don’t forget the power of accessories. A carefully chosen art print of a local beachscape, a mirror framed with seashells, or a bowl filled with sand and beach glass can make a significant impact.

Modern Interior Inspirations

While appreciating local artistry provides a unique charm, incorporating modern interior inspirations can offer a fresh, sleek edge to your Naples home. Introducing modern elements into your home doesn’t mean abandoning traditional features; instead, it’s about blending the old with the new to create a timeless aesthetic that’s uniquely yours.

Modern interior design is all about simplicity, functionality, and clean lines. It’s about stripping back to basics and letting the core elements of a room speak for themselves. Consider incorporating open floor plans, minimalistic furniture, and high-quality materials to achieve this look.

To help you get started, here’s a table illustrating some key modern interior design elements:

Design Element Description Example
Open Floor Plans Spacious, free-flowing layouts with minimal walls or partitions Open-concept living room and kitchen
Minimalistic Furniture Furniture with clean lines and simple forms A sleek, low-profile sofa
High-Quality Materials Use of natural materials like wood and stone, or modern materials like metal and glass A marble countertop or a steel pendant light

To successfully incorporate these elements, you’ll need to maintain a balance. Too many elements and your home may feel cold and sterile. Too little, and it may lose its modern appeal. Choosing the Right Colors

selecting colors for design

Dipping into the color palette, it’s essential to understand that the right hues can dramatically transform the ambiance of your Naples home, reflecting not just your personal style, but also the energy you want each space to radiate. Colors are more than just aesthetic choices; they’re a silent language, evoking emotions and moods. They can calm or invigorate, make a room feel airy or cozy. Your decisions should be calculated, thoughtful, and in harmony with the unique architecture and lighting in each room.

Imagine your living room bathed in soothing blues and greens, colors reminiscent of the beautiful Gulf of Naples, offering a tranquil retreat from the hustle and bustle. Your kitchen, perhaps, could burst with the vibrant yellows and oranges of a Neapolitan sunrise, an invigorating backdrop to the heart of your home. Bedrooms might benefit from soft, muted tones, promoting relaxation and sleep.

However, it’s not just about the walls. The color palette extends to your furniture, fabrics, and accessories. These elements shouldn’t be in competition but in conversation with each other, creating a balanced, harmonious space.

Consider also the transitions between rooms. The colors should flow naturally, leading the eye from one space to the next with ease and fluidity.
